Transaction cd75230b4e6d96c1ae759c514569b5197f8484a7c73eb07e1a5f89cdc6b8ed51

10 Input
2 Outputs
  • cd75230b4e6d96c1ae759c514569b5197f8484a7c73eb07e1a5f89cdc6b8ed51:0
  • value  577153
    address  bc1qf8f9snm92yvrv8y484cynku5y98mf6uhfcnhew
  • cd75230b4e6d96c1ae759c514569b5197f8484a7c73eb07e1a5f89cdc6b8ed51:1
  • value  705926054
    address  3EvGRFVM81WKYVjscg1f1LYjjkZ4ik3BF2